What is Remedial Biology?

Remedial Biology provides foundational knowledge of biology for pharmacy students who have not studied biology at the higher secondary level. It covers basic concepts of botany and zoology, focusing on human biology and plants of pharmaceutical importance.

Course Units

Unit 1: Partial Fractions, Logarithms, Functions, and Limits

Topics Covered: Introduction to polynomials, rational fractions, proper and improper fractions, resolving into partial fractions with applications in chemical kinetics and pharmacokinetics, fundamentals of logarithms including properties, characteristic and mantissa with pharmaceutical applications, real valued functions and their classification, and the concept of limits and continuity with definitions and examples.

Unit 2: Matrices and Determinants

Topics Covered: Introduction, types, and operations on matrices, transpose, multiplication, determinants with their properties, minors, cofactors, adjoint, singular and non-singular matrices, inverse of a matrix, solving systems of linear equations using matrix method and Cramer’s rule, characteristic equation, roots of matrices, Cayley–Hamilton theorem, and applications of matrices in solving pharmacokinetic equations.

Unit 3: Calculus – Differentiation

Topics Covered: Explains the basics of differentiation, derivatives of functions and constants, product rule, sum and difference rule, quotient rule (without proof), and practical applications in problem-solving.

Unit 4: Analytical Geometry and Integration

Topics Covered: Introduction to coordinate geometry including signs of coordinates, distance formula, slope of a straight line, conditions for parallelism and perpendicularity, slope-intercept form, and applications; introduction to integration with standard formulas, rules, substitution method, partial fractions method, integration by parts, definite integrals, and applications.

Unit 5: Differential Equations and Laplace Transform

Topics Covered: Defines order and degree of differential equations, equations in separable, homogeneous, linear, and exact forms with applications in pharmacokinetics; introduction to Laplace transforms with definitions, properties, transforms of elementary functions, inverse Laplace transforms, Laplace of derivatives, and applications in solving linear differential equations, chemical kinetics, and pharmacokinetic problems.
